1 psi equals about
0.0689 bar
Psi (pounds per square inch) is the pressure unit of the British/American imperial system, used mainly in the United States for tire pressure, plumbing, and industrial equipment, while the bar is the equivalent metric unit common in Europe and most of the world.
To convert a measurement from psi to bar, simply multiply the value by 0.0689:
To convert from bar to psi, perform the inverse operation, multiplying by 14.5038:
